首页/翻墙加速器/深入解析VPN连接错误代码691,原因、排查与解决方案

深入解析VPN连接错误代码691,原因、排查与解决方案

在现代网络环境中,虚拟私人网络(VPN)已成为企业远程办公、个人隐私保护和跨境访问的重要工具,在使用过程中,用户经常会遇到各种错误提示,错误代码691”是最常见且令人困扰的问题之一,该错误通常出现在Windows系统尝试建立PPTP或L2TP/IPSec类型的VPN连接时,提示“远程服务器拒绝连接”,意味着认证失败或配置异常,作为网络工程师,本文将从技术角度深入分析691错误的成因,并提供系统化的排查步骤与实用解决方案。

理解错误代码691的本质至关重要,它并非表示网络不通或物理链路故障,而是认证层的失败,当客户端向远程VPN服务器发送用户名和密码后,若服务器验证失败(如账号不存在、密码错误、账户被锁定或证书不匹配),就会返回此错误码,这通常发生在以下几种场景:

  1. 用户名或密码错误:最常见的情况是用户输入了错误的凭据,尤其是大小写敏感或包含特殊字符时容易出错。
  2. 账户未启用或被禁用:远程服务器上的用户账户可能因管理员操作被停用,或者在域环境中未正确分配权限。
  3. 身份验证协议不匹配:客户端配置为使用PAP协议,但服务器要求CHAP或MS-CHAPv2,导致协商失败。
  4. 服务器资源限制:某些VPN服务器对并发连接数有限制,如果已达到上限,新连接会被拒绝。
  5. 防火墙或NAT设备拦截:部分网络设备会阻止PPTP使用的TCP 1723端口或GRE协议(协议号47),造成连接无法完成。
  6. 本地策略或组策略冲突:企业环境中,本地安全策略可能强制要求特定加密方式,与服务器配置不一致。

解决这一问题需按以下顺序排查:

  • 第一步:确认用户名和密码准确无误,建议在本地测试账号是否可用;
  • 第二步:检查服务器日志(如Windows事件查看器中的“远程访问”日志),定位具体失败原因;
  • 第三步:确保客户端和服务器使用相同的认证协议(推荐MS-CHAPv2);
  • 第四步:通过telnet测试端口连通性(如telnet <服务器IP> 1723),排除防火墙干扰;
  • 第五步:联系网络管理员确认账户状态和服务器负载情况;
  • 第六步:若为公司内网,可尝试切换至更安全的OpenVPN或WireGuard协议替代PPTP。

值得注意的是,PPTP协议由于安全性较低(易受中间人攻击)已被许多厂商弃用,建议逐步迁移至更现代的隧道协议,错误代码691虽常见,但通过分层排查和规范配置,完全可以快速定位并修复,从而保障远程访问的稳定性和安全性。

深入解析VPN连接错误代码691,原因、排查与解决方案

本文转载自互联网,如有侵权,联系删除